The Boys in the Bar
- 16.
- Season: 1
- Episode: 16
- First Aired: 1/27/1983
- Prod Code: 015
Cheers' regulars fear the place may become a gay hangout after an old friend and teammate of Sam's reveals his homosexuality in a tell-all book. Add a recap »

- Won a Media Award from GLAAD (Gay & Lesbian Alliance Against Defamation). edit »
- Writers/co-producers Ken Levine & David Isaacs earned a 1983 Emmy nomination for Best Writing in a Comedy Series for their script. Levine & Isaacs would leave "Cheers" in 1983 (for "AfterMASH," then "Mary") but serve as periodic creative consultants and frequent contributors throughout "Cheers'" eleven-year run. edit »
